diff --git a/qemu/target-i386/helper.c b/qemu/target-i386/helper.c index cda0390..e468366 100644 --- a/qemu/target-i386/helper.c +++ b/qemu/target-i386/helper.c @@ -1387,7 +1387,7 @@ static void host_cpuid(uint32_t function, uint32_t *eax, uint32_t *ebx, asm volatile("cpuid" : "=a"(vec[0]), "=b"(vec[1]), "=c"(vec[2]), "=d"(vec[3]) - : "0"(function) : "cc"); + : "0"(function), "c"(*ecx) : "cc"); #else asm volatile("pusha \n\t" "cpuid \n\t" @@ -1396,7 +1396,7 @@ static void host_cpuid(uint32_t function, uint32_t *eax, uint32_t *ebx, "mov %%ecx, 8(%1) \n\t" "mov %%edx, 12(%1) \n\t" "popa" - : : "a"(function), "S"(vec) + : : "a"(function), "c"(*ecx), "S"(vec) : "memory", "cc"); #endif @@ -1483,7 +1483,6 @@ void cpu_x86_cpuid(CPUX86State *env, uint32_t index, *edx = 0; break; } - break; case 5: /* mwait info: needed for Core compatibility */ @@ -1526,9 +1525,9 @@ void cpu_x86_cpuid(CPUX86State *env, uint32_t index, *edx = env->cpuid_ext2_features; if (kvm_enabled()) { - uint32_t h_eax, h_edx; + uint32_t h_eax, h_edx, h_ecx; - host_cpuid(0x80000001, &h_eax, NULL, NULL, &h_edx); + host_cpuid(0x80000001, &h_eax, NULL, &h_ecx, &h_edx); /* disable CPU features that the host does not support */
The CPUID instruction takes the value of ECX as an input parameter in addition to the value of EAX for function 4. Make sure we pass the value to the instruction.
